@1point7g If you're going to be going there anyway then just apply for accommodation. However, because you're living in London already, you wont be prioritised. I also live in London and went QM - I was on the waiting list for accommodation until January of my first year which is when I moved in. If you don't get halls (or are on the waiting list) and you're desperate to live close to university, you might want to consider Unite Halls. Check it out on google
